Nomination periods

Autumn semester or full academic year15 March - 15 April
Spring semester1 September - 1 October

Other procedures apply for Music Studies: Applicants to Music performance and Music composition should not be nominated by their home university, but must apply in the EASY Mobility Online by 1 March every year.

Students applying for Spring 2025 must be nominated during 1 September - 1 October. 

Application deadline for students

Autumn semester or full academic year25 April
Spring semester15 October

Nomination web - how to register your students

During the nomination period 15 March - 15 April you may only nominate students for the autumn semester or full academic year. Students coming for Spring 2025 must be nominated during the next nomination period. 

1. Choose agreement

After login, you will see an overview of the agreements you can access with your username. Select the relevant agreement and choose Add new nomination to nominate a student on the agreement. 

If you can't find the relevant agreement/ subject area in Nomination web that you are responsible for, please email us at incoming@uib.no and we will check whether your email is registered correctly in our database. 

    If you want to nominate your student(s) for two semesters, but are only able to nominate for one semester, please nominate your student for one semester and then email us at incoming@uib.no and explain the situation. We will make the necessary changes in the system.

    If you have questions regarding the number of nominees, courses or any other issues related to your agreement(s) with UiB, you should contact your partner at the department or faculty. For university wide agreements you can contact incoming@uib.no.

    2. Register nominated students

    • Email address
    • Name (according to passport)
    • Gender
    • Date of birth in the format YYYY.MM.DD
    • Citizenship (according to passport)
    • Semester/s for admission
      • autumn/ autumn+spring
      • spring/ spring+autumn

    After completing the student's information, click on "Add Nomination" to save the data. 

    3. Upload documents

    Partners can on behalf of their students upload the required documentation in Nomination web. We accept unofficial transcripts, translations, and documentation of funds (Non-EU/EEA students) when uploaded by our partner universities on behalf of the student.

    4. Confirmation email

    The nominated students will receive a confirmation email (cc to nominator) approximately 30 minutes after after their nomination was registered in Nomination web. In addition the students will receive an email with their password needed in order to access their online application. 

    Nominated students can apply in our online application system (Søknadsweb) as soon as they have received the confirmation email.

    5. Add another nomination

    Complete steps 2 and 3 for each student you wish to nominate for exchange. Partners can nominate students during the nomination period 15 March - 15 April. 

    Change nomination

    Please note that nominations cannot be edited. I you registered incorrect data, you must delete the nomination using the delete button (red circle with the white cross), and then click “Add New Nomination” to start the process again.

    If you are not able to delete the nomination, email us at incoming@uib.no for assistance.

    Course limitations

    We expect partners to nominate their students within the subject area specified in our agreeement. Students may in addition choose courses from other subject areas (mainly open courses), preferably at the same faculty. 

    If a course has a limited amount of places, students nominated on an exchange agreement in the relevant subject area will be prioritised.

    Subject areas not open for exchange students

    The following subject areas are not open for exchange students unless otherwise specified in the exchange agreement:

    • Medicine
    • Dentistry
    • Music - Performance and Composition
    • Fine Art
    • Design

    English language requirements

    All courses for exchange students are carried out in English and we expect that your students have sufficient fluency in English in order to cope with the courses from the beginning of the semester.

    General courses for exchange students

    Students are required to have a minimum of level B2 (CEFR) for all courses offered to exchange students, except for courses in English language and literature. We consider your nomination as confirmation of your students' English proficiency at level B2.

    Courses in English language and literature

    Courses in English language and literature have course codes starting with ENG[xxx]. Students who apply to take ENG-courses must have a minimum of level C1 (CEFR). The students must document their English level by submitting a test to their application.

    Admission period and letter of acceptance

    Partners can check the status of their students' application by log in at Nomination web.

    Letter of Acceptance

    Students will receive the Letter of Acceptance online through Søknadsweb (UiB online application system): 

    • by 10 June for students starting in August.
    • by 30 November for students starting in January.

    Students will be notified by email soon after the letters have been published. The acceptance letter can be downloaded by the student as a pdf document. We do not sent copies of the Letter of Acceptance to our partners.

    Students from the same home university will not necessarily receive their Letter of Acceptance at the same day. We publish Letters of Acceptance from end of May until 10 June / mid-November until the end of November, regardless of which home university the students belong to.

    The processing of a student's application can be delayed for several reasons, the most common one being that we are missing one or more of the required documents. In these cases we will email the student directly with information about what is missing and what the student should do next.

    Please ask your students to check their email regularly, including the spam filter.

    Student housing

    The Student Welfare Organisation (Sammen) in Bergen offers student housing to new international students. Exchange students are entitled to housing guarantee if they apply in Sammen's application portal within the following dates:

    • Autumn semester (start August): 1 April - 10 May
    • Spring semester (start January): 1 October - 1 November

    The students will receive an offer from Sammen shortly after the deadlines 10 May / 1 November. If the students plan to accept the offer, they need to sign the tenancy agreement within the given deadline, even if their admission at UiB is still under consideration.

    The tenancy agreement is a legal binding agreement between the student and Sammen. Please advise your students to read the document carefully and get familiarized with the terms and conditions given in the agreement.

    Shared rooms will be allocated to short term students (1 semester stay). Allocations are randomised.

    Cancellation

    Students that withdraw from their exchange at UIB must make sure that they cancel the tenancy agreement within Sammen's cancellation deadlines:

    • Autumn semester (start August): 24 June
    • Spring semester (start January): 30 November

    They need to notify Sammen by email bolig@sammen.no with a copy to incoming@uib.no.

    Students who do not cancel the tenancy agreement within the deadline, will have to pay rent for minimum five months (autumn semester) or six months (spring semester). 

    Students with special needs

    Sammen can offer rooms / apartments that are specially adapted for students with special needs. The student must notify Sammen as soon as possible and after the application is submitted, by sending an email to bolig@sammen.no 

    Study permit and police registration

    Non-EU/EFTA citizens must apply for a study permit after receiving the Letter of Acceptance from the University of Bergen. This also applies for non-EU/EFTA citizens with a Schengen residence permit

    EU/EFTA citizens do not need to apply for a study permit, but the police's Immigration Office (UDI) requires that students register online as soon as possible after they have arrived in Bergen.

    Nordic citizens do not need a study permit to study in Norway, but may register with the National Registry if living in Norway for more than 6 months.

    Extension of study period

    Exchange students can apply to extend their study period with one semester. The exchange period is limited to maximum one academic year (two semester). This applies regardless of whether there were two non-contiguous periods.

    A satisfactory study progress equal to a semester workload of 30 credits is required. Extensions are subjected to courses availability and overall study progress. 

    Partners do not have to nominate the students again. However, the extension must be included in the total number of nominated students.

    Applications deadline:

    • Autumn semester: 1 June*
    • Spring semester: 15 October*

    * No extension will be given beyond this deadline. 

    Students apply for extension following the instructions given here.  Official confimation of extension signed by the erasmus coordinator at home institution is required. 

    Transcript of records

    UiB has replaced the transcript of records on paper with digital services. All students must order a transcript of records with a digital signature from the Diploma Registry. Partners will able to check the validity of a digital transcript or certified link.

    In Norway we use the grading scale A-F, or “Pass”/”Fail”, in higher education. Please see our information website about the grading system for full details on what the grades mean.
